FilterEditorControl.AllowAggregateEditing Property

Gets or sets whether filters can be created against properties that are List objects.

Namespace : DevExpress.DataAccess.UI

Assembly : DevExpress.DataAccess.v25.2.UI.dll

NuGet Package : DevExpress.DataAccess.UI

Declaration

csharp
[DefaultValue(FilterControlAllowAggregateEditing.No)]
[DXCategory("Behavior")]
public FilterControlAllowAggregateEditing AllowAggregateEditing { get; set; }
vb
<DXCategory("Behavior")>
<DefaultValue(FilterControlAllowAggregateEditing.No)>
Public Property AllowAggregateEditing As FilterControlAllowAggregateEditing

Property Value

TypeDefaultDescription
FilterControlAllowAggregateEditingNo

A FilterControlAllowAggregateEditing enumeration value that specifies whether or not filters can be created against properties that are List objects.

|

Available values:

NameDescription
No

Doesn’t allow filters to be created against List properties and against their children.

| | Aggregate |

Allows filters to be created against properties that are List objects.

| | AggregateWithCondition |

Allows filters to be created against properties that are List objects, and against the List’s children.

|

Remarks

If a property of the IList type is marked with the AggregatedAttribute attribute, filters cannot be created against this property.
